Start Small

"Little Otter Learns to Swim," authored by Artie Knapp, AIS ’04, and illustrated by Guy Hobbs, teaches children the value of persistence in overcoming fears and challenges when acquiring new skills, using North American river otters as inspiration. The book, published by ºÚÁÏÊÓÆµ Press, also pays tribute to the species and incorporates conservation messages contributed by the River Otter Ecology Project.
